Output 43fffdeaaba30dfaa1ea790e81a049fbee5cddbf865b040d3a43af5f86401391:0
- value
- 21160036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b9113e26db8af0f92c3ecffe660bf6a5ff6e6ab OP_EQUAL
- address
- 3CxNqK5843NVkieKVLteRTqE7gs7XkXss4
- transaction
- 43fffdeaaba30dfaa1ea790e81a049fbee5cddbf865b040d3a43af5f86401391
- confirmations
- 289324
- spent
- true